Patna : World No 27 in WTA rankings Lesia Tsurenko, 29, Ukraine, entered the women’s singles final of Brisbane International 2019 at Brisbane, Queensland, Australia, on January 5, 2019. Tsurenko beat World No 5 and reigning US Open champion Naomi Osaka, 21, Japan, 6-2, 6-4 in the semi-finals.

Osaka fired 8 Aces in the match to 6 by Tsurenko. Both the players committed 2 double faults each in the match. Tsurenko, however, won 3 break points besides winning 5 games in a row. Tsurenko won 39 service points to 31 by Osaka. Tsurenko had defeated World No 21 Anett Kontaveit, 23, Estonia, in the quarter-finals.
